THE POWER OF PARADIGM SHIFT

A shift in paradigm is basically a change in the one way/normal way of thinking or doing things. Thus, understanding why some things happen not because its normal but there are reasons for which they happen. A quick one; Steve Covey in his book "Seven Habits of Highly effective people" cited a good example from a mini paradigm shift he experienced. He was waiting for a bus with others at a subway in New York. Some were reading news papers, some lost in thought and others resting with their eyes closed. It was a calm and peaceful scene.Then suddenly a man and his children entered the subway car. The children were so loud and rambunctious that instantly the whole climate changed. The man sat down next to Steve and closed his eyes, apparently oblivious to the situation.The children were yelling back and forth, throwing things even grabbing people's papers.
